The Complexity of Human Language

Human language is extraordinarily complex, involving nuances, context, and cultural references that are difficult for AI to master. Spelling Bees, in particular, require a deep understanding of:

  • Etymology: The origin and historical development of words.
  • Phonetics: The sounds of words and how they are pronounced.
  • Rules and Exceptions: English spelling rules are full of exceptions and irregularities.

The AI vs. Human Brain

While AI excels at tasks involving data processing and pattern recognition, language tasks require a different kind of intelligence:

  • Contextual Understanding: Humans understand context intuitively. For instance, the word "lead" can mean to guide or a type of metal, depending on the context.
  • Intuition and Guesswork: Humans can make educated guesses based on partial knowledge, an area where AI still lags.
  • Learning Nuances: Humans can learn and adapt to new linguistic nuances rapidly, something that requires extensive training for AI.

AI’s Current Capabilities

Despite its limitations, AI has made significant strides in language processing:

  • Natural Language Processing (NLP): AI can analyze and generate human language with impressive accuracy. Tools like GPT-4 can generate coherent and contextually relevant text.
  • Spelling and Grammar Checks: Applications like Grammarly use AI to correct spelling and grammar mistakes effectively.
  • Voice Recognition: AI assistants like Siri and Alexa can understand and respond to spoken language.

The Spelling Bee Challenge

Spelling Bees present unique challenges even for advanced AI:

  • Rare and Complex Words: Spelling Bees often include rare words that aren't commonly used or encountered, making it difficult for AI to have a reference point.
  • Ambiguity in Pronunciation: Many words have multiple pronunciations, adding to the complexity.
  • Cultural and Regional Variations: Accents, dialects, and regional variations in pronunciation add another layer of difficulty for AI.
